First and foremost, it is crucial to remain calm and composed when you are accused of stealing money. Do not let your emotions get the best of you. Take a deep breath and try to think logically. Remember that you are innocent until proven guilty. You have the right to defend yourself and clear your name. The next step is to gather evidence that proves your innocence. If you have any receipts, bank statements, or other documents that support your claim, make sure to present them. You can also ask for witnesses who can testify on your behalf. In some cases, it may be necessary to hire a lawyer to help you with legal proceedings. It is also important to communicate effectively with the accuser. Ask them to provide you with specific details about the alleged theft, such as the time and place it occurred, the amount of money involved, and any other relevant information. Be polite and respectful, but firm in your defense. Do not admit to any wrongdoing if you are innocent. If the accuser refuses to listen to reason and insists on pursuing legal action, you may need to seek professional help. A lawyer can advise you on your legal rights and help you navigate the legal system. They can also negotiate with the accuser to resolve the matter outside of court.
